Shuli Niu is a professor in Institute of Geographic Sciences and Natural Resources Research (IGSNRR), Chinese Academy of Sciences. She received her PhD from the Institute of Botany, Chinese Academy of Sciences, in 2004. From 2008 to 2012, she worked as a visiting scholar and postdoc research fellow at the Department of Microbiology and Plant Biology, University of Oklahoma, USA. Her research interests include, but not limited to, global change and terrestrial ecosystem. By using global change manipulative experiments and data synthesis, she studied biodiversity and ecosystem carbon, nitrogen and water cycles in response to climate change and human disturbance. Her study comprehensively revealed the regulation mechanisms of climate-carbon cycle feedback. Dr. Niu has published more than 200 peer-reviewed papers in international journals, which have been cited over 22,000 times with an H index of 79. She has served as associate editors of Ecology Letters, Functional Ecology, Journal of Geophysical Research-Biogeosciences, and Ecological Processes.
